  • Recommendations

    Tactics

    Work the cover — snags, weed edges, hole entrances; retrieve the lure with pauses.

    Lures

    In clear water, natural colors work best: small jig or minnow bait.

    Gear

    It's a hot day — a hat, sunglasses, and plenty of water are a must.
